Thanks for not including me in your "lazy YC moneybags" derogatory swipe.

I'm not sure how it is that your perception of YC members who give $500 per year ($41.67 per month) to be able to sit in the middle sections of the stadium translates into either "lazy" or "moneybags". The majority of YC donors are between $10 and $1,000 ($83.33 per month) each year.

As is the case in every year I've volunteered with the Yosef Club, the $100 - $500 donors are every bit as important as the $5,000 - $10,000 donors. In fact, every Yosef Club Advisory Board meeting I've attended in the last 12 years of service contains discussions about how we can engage potential faithful donors whose annual gifts are in the $100 - $500 range.

Somewhere along the line, you and others like you either were given or decided upon the perception that those $100 gifts were not welcome. I've spent 12 years as a volunteer working with Yosef staff and other volunteers to engage as many donors and potential donors as possible. There's an old saying that "no single raindrop believes it is responsible for the flood". In that same manner, 1,000 additional donors at the $100 level ($8.33 per month) would fund $100,000 each year. That's significant in anyone's book. Imagine the difference that would be made if 10% of Appalachian alumni all donated $100 per year ... $100 times roughly 13,000 is $1,300,000. We'd have a "flood" in no time at all from those vital donations and free up resources for facility upgrades, coaching salaries, travel, additional scholarships ... you get the picture.

@NoLongerLurking, I implore you to rethink how you see those Yosef donors who have chosen to donate the cost of a meal ($8.33 - $41.67) each month to support our student-athletes.
